Red eyes
by
Alfy Andrews
Have we thought, what it costs to be diligent
Let us ask the ants which slumber not
They say, little sleep to eyes ,make it red hot
For time and oppurtunities live short
If we want to stand before mighty kings
Let us all be passionate to do God's will
Hard work and His will done alone brings
Showers of blessings from His treasure mill.
